    What Are SQP Reports?

    Search Query Performance (SQP) reports are official documents provided by Amazon that offer deep insights into customer search behavior. Sourced directly from Amazon Brand Analytics, this data reveals the exact search terms shoppers use to find your products, how clicks are distributed across the market, and which keywords actually drive purchases.

    Why Use the SoldScope SQP Analyzer?

    Instead of guessing why conversions are fluctuating, the SQP Analyzer provides the context of the total market size. You can easily see if your share dropped while the market stayed stable, or if both your share and overall demand declined simultaneously.

    While this data is available inside Amazon Seller Central, the native interface is often limited to rigid, raw data tables. SoldScope offers a completely different interpretation and significantly expands your analytical capabilities:

    • PPC Data Integration: We combine your organic SQP metrics with your advertising data at the ASIN level. This gives you the complete picture: you can see exactly which keywords you are winning because of ads, where your ad spend is having no impact on visibility, and how PPC influences your overall market share. (Note: Viewing these specific metrics requires an active connection to your Amazon Ads account).

    • Flexible Analytics & Customization: Instead of Amazon's static reports, you get a fully interactive dashboard. The ability to customize visual charts and apply deep, multi-level data grouping saves you hours of manual spreadsheet work.

    Selecting Your Data for Analysis

    SQP Analyzer Filters

    Before diving into the metrics, set your parameters to focus on the exact data you need and filter out the noise:

    1. Set Core Parameters: Use the top bar to select your Account and Marketplace. Selecting a specific product is optional if left blank, the tool will analyze data across all products in your account.

    2. Define the Timeframe: Switch between Weekly and Monthly views, then select your specific date range to analyze short-term fluctuations or long-term market trends.

    3. Filter Keywords: Narrow down the search terms using filters for Search Volume, Word Count, or specific Phrase inclusions/exclusions. This removes irrelevant keywords that typically clutter standard SQP reports.
